FINA 491 - Finance Internship II

Institution:
Lander University
Subject:
Finance
Description:
FINA 491.FINANCE INTERNSHIP II This course will provide practical work experience in the financial services field through an approved agency or business under the supervision of professional employees and the course instructor. The course may be taken for a maximum of 6 hours and be used as a business elective or general elective. Internship is dependent upon position availability. Prerequisites: Instructor permission, and junior or senior status, "C" or better in ACCT 201, MATH 211, and either ECON 101 or ECON 201 or ECON 202. One to six credit hours.
